      Donald R. Rarric was born on 3-Jan-1927. He was the son of William Rarric and Nancy Van Voorhis. Donald R. Rarric died on 25-May-2000 at Canton, Stark County, Ohio, at age 73. Donald was buried at Mapleton Cemetery, Canton, Stark County, Ohio.
     He began military service on 19-Apr-1945 at Cleveland, Cuyahoga County, Ohio; Private U. S. Army; 2 years of high school, single without dependents. He served as a PFC during WWII.

Delbert E. Rarric, Sr.
Delbert E. Rarric, Sr., age 75, passed away Sunday morning after a lengthy illness. Born a son of the late William and Nancy Van Vooris Rarric, he was a life resident of the area. He retired in 1973 from Stark Ceramics after 16 years service where he drilled coal. Survived by his wife, Edna Rarric, with whom he would have celebrated their 51st Wedding Anniversary on October 22nd; two daughters and sons-in-law, Debra and William Critchfield, of East Sparta, and Cheryl and Donald Hole, of Manteo, NC; three sons and one daughter-in-law, Delbert Rarric, Jr. and David and Caroline Rarric, all of Macon, GA, and Ronald Rarric, of Magnolia; two sisters; nine grandchildren and four great grandchildren.       Robert E. Spielman was born on 22-Feb-1947 at Beloit City, Mitchell County, Kansas. He was the son of Hubert Marion Spielman and Ruth E. Becker. Robert E. Spielman died on 26-Feb-2009 at Lyons, Rice County, Kansas, at age 62.
     

Wednesday, Mar 04, 2009
LYONS ­ Robert E. Spielman, 62, died Thursday, Feb. 26, 2009, at his residence in Lyons.

He was born Feb. 22, 1947, in Beloit, the son of Hubert M. and Ruth E. Becker Spielman. He graduated from Simpson High School in Simpson, received an Associates Degree from York College, York, Neb., and a Bachelors degree from Kansas State University.

He married Sheila Needham in Abilene on Oct. 4, 1969.

He moved to Lyons in 1974. He was a member of the Church of Christ in Lyons, the Rotary Club where he was a Paul Harris Fellow, AICPA, KSCPA, past president and member of USD 405 School Board, Silver Maple Camp Board, past Lyons Chamber of Commerce board member, and a former member of the Board of Trustees at York College.

Survivors include his wife, Sheila of the home; two daughters, Shaeley Santiago and husband Anthony of Ames, Ia., Junessa Dodds and husband Kevin of Colorado Springs, Colo; a sister, Barbara Axtell and husband Charles of Beloit; his mother-in-law, Billie Needham of Abilene; five brothers and sisters-in-law, Gary and Carol Needham, Loyd and Carol Needham, both of Abilene, Scot and Dayna Needham of McPherson, Wade and Lola Needham, Sandy and Rod Paulson, both of Abilene, Phil and Shelley Needham of Freeman, Mo; four grandchildren, Malkan and Kaysia Santiago, Isaac and Hosea Dodds.

He was preceded in death by his parents.

Alta M. Sauerman

Funeral for Alta M. Sauerman, 73, Lawton, will be at 2 p.m. Tuesday
at Liberty Heights Christian Church with the Rev. Charles Pettigrew,
pastor, officiating.

Mrs. Sauerman died Friday, June 6, 2003, at her home.

Burial will be at Highland Cemetery under direction of Becker Funeral
Home.

She was born Nov. 23, 1929, in rural Custer City to Francis and Mable
Jewel Rayner. She graduated from Arapaho High School in 1948. She
married Norman R. Monroe on Feb. 10, 1951, in Clinton. He died July
22, 1963. She married James G. Sauerman on May 13, 1966, in the
Methodist church in Waurika. Mrs. Sauerman was employed at Cameron
University for four years. She later graduated from Southwestern
State University, Weatherford, with a degree in elementary education
in 1965. She taught at Taft Elementary School in Lawton for two
years, then taught at Wilson Elementary School until 1993 when she
retired. She was a member of Liberty Heights Christian Church for 43
years, serving as deacon, elder, Sunday school teacher and Sunday
school superintendent. She taught in Vacation Bible School, served on
many committees, sang in the choir, searched for ministers, and other
duties as required. She was an active member of the Gamma Mu Conclave
of Kappa Kappa Iota Teachers Sorority for 20 years. She held all
offices and was president in 2002-2003.

      Bonnie Jewel Rayner was born on 12-Mar-1934 at Grant, Custer County, Oklahoma. She was the daughter of Francis Allen Rayner and Mabel Jewel Hall. Bonnie Jewel Rayner died on 7-Sep-2006 at age 72. Bonnie was buried at Fort Leavenworth National Cemetery, Leavenworth, Crawford County, Kansas.
     

Bonnie was the youngest child of Francis and Mabel Rayner. She married Franklin DuWayne Clinkingbeard at Fort Sill, Oklahoma on Sept. 6, 1956. Bonnie was a teacher and retired in 1995 after 28.5 years of service.
